FDA-approved uses of beta-1-selective blockers include hypertension, chronic stable angina, heart failure, post-myocardial infarction, and decreased left ventricular function after a recent myocardial infarction.

Beta-blockers are a class of medicines most commonly used for problems involving your heart and circulatory system. They can also help treat conditions related to your brain and nervous system. Beta-blockers work by slowing down certain types of cell activity.Beta blockers, also known as beta-adrenergic blocking agents, are a class of drugs that works by blocking the neurotransmitters norepinephrine and epinephrine from binding to receptors. There are three known types of beta receptors, known as beta 1 (β 1), beta 2 (β 2) and beta 3 (β 3). Selective beta blockers mainly target beta-1 receptors (chemical binding sites). These receptors affect your heart rate and how hard your heart works to pump blood. Non-selective beta blockers attach to beta-1, beta-2, and sometimes alpha receptors. Beta-blockers, as a class of drugs, are primarily used to treat cardiovascular diseases and other conditions. Beta receptors exist in three distinct forms: beta-1 (B1), beta-2 (B2), and beta-3 (B3). Beta-1 receptors located primarily in the heart mediate cardiac activity.

What are Cardioselective beta blockers? Beta-adrenergic blocking agents prevent stimulation of the beta-1 adrenergic receptors at the nerve endings of the sympathetic nervous system and therefore decrease the activity of the heart.
